The 40mm grenade launcher (M203) mounted on the M16A3 rifle has a maximum range of how many meters?

Final answer:

The M203 grenade launcher mounted on the M16A3 rifle has an approximate maximum range of 400 meters, but various factors such as muzzle velocity and air resistance can influence its actual performance.

Step-by-step explanation:

The 40mm grenade launcher (M203) mounted on the M16A3 rifle has a maximum range of approximately 400 meters. This range can vary based on several factors, including the type of grenade, the angle of launch, and environmental conditions.

In the context of projectile motion, the maximum range is achieved when a projectile is launched at an angle of 45 degrees in a vacuum without air resistance; however, practical factors such as the aforementioned can influence the actual range.

When discussing projectile motion, it's important to consider factors such as gravity, air resistance, and muzzle velocity. A higher muzzle velocity would project the grenade farther before gravity significantly affects its trajectory, potentially increasing the maximum range.

However, air resistance can reduce the range by slowing down the projectile. Additionally, trajectory optimization often involves aiming the projectile slightly higher to compensate for the downward pull of gravity over long distances.
